The Fuji apple has a very unique history. Originally from Japan, it is a cross between the Red Delicious and Ralls Janet, which, by the way, is an antique variety that dates all the way back in Thomas Jefferson. Known as Tohoku apples, in Japan, this variety was first established in 1939. It wasn't until the early 1960s, that they were introduced to America with a new name.
